My Bloody Valentine Return With First Album In 12 Years

03 February 2013

My Bloody Valentine Return With First Album In 12 Years

Conducting the release of their third album like it was some clandestine operation, My Bloody Valentine have finally released the follow-up to 1991's Loveless through their website.

The band announced the arrival of their album, titled m b v, through their Facebook page last night, posting, "We are preparing to go live with the new album/website this evening. We will make an announcement as soon as its up." Soon enough, the band relaunched their website, mybloodyvalentine.org, giving fans the chance to download the new release in the most modern fashion possible.

Earlier this week, the band's frontman Kevin Shields said the long-awaited new album "might be out in two or three days" and with the album launch late last night (Feb 2) he proved to be a man of his word. The band will be heading out on a small UK tour in March to promote the album further, following a series of gigs they have planned in Japan and Australia. MBV will be heading back to Japan in the summer to headline Tokyo Rocks and will also be playing Primavera in Barcelona.

According to the band's website, the artwork for the vinyl and CD covers is still incomplete, but when it is done each format will have slightly different, but similar artwork to the download. You can buy the album from the band's website now.

Their UK tour will see them play: 

March 8 - Birmingham O2 Academy

March 9 - Glasgow Barrowlands

March 10 - Manchester Apollo

March 12 + 13 - London Hammersmith Apollo
